Responsibilities

  • Plan, implement, and manage identity and access management solutions
  • Monitor activity logs to identify security incidents
  • Keep up to date with the latest industry developments and trends
  • Monitor compliance with internal policies and external regulations
  • Auditing of systems
  • Support tickets

Qualifications

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in computer related field
  • Minimum 3 to 5 years experience in an infrastructure support role
  • Server hardware install and configure experience
  • Experience supporting multi-location enterprise environment or 1000+ users
  • Hypervisor management - VMware
  • Backup experience
  • Power BI, PowerShell, DHCP

Preferred Experience

  • Veeam backup software
  • Data center
